Transaction 83cb3afdd4dfef4b0f9001d7712403daaac3c25ee2113c652a3b4232a79ce6f7

3 Input
2 Outputs
  • 83cb3afdd4dfef4b0f9001d7712403daaac3c25ee2113c652a3b4232a79ce6f7:0
  • value  29965896
    address  1LcFTV8ez4EgTKAHmLUPJrizSeDpeB5KY1
  • 83cb3afdd4dfef4b0f9001d7712403daaac3c25ee2113c652a3b4232a79ce6f7:1
  • value  40000000
    address  3Msr5taop9d8AGJw1vCZXf9QW9wVeeNDVe